Opinion: The murky practice of influencer marketing

In public relations, we have always ascribed to the power of so-called earned coverage and endorsements. Unlike advertising, PR can give the public opinions and information from media and online influencers that is not paid for and therefore comes with a higher level of trust and reliability.
